Remark (german): Für die Zusatzgefahr siehe 2.0.5.6: Subsidiary hazards shall be representative of the primary hazard posed by the other dangerous goods contained within the article or they shall be the subsidiary hazard(s) identified in column 4 of the Dangerous Goods List when only one dangerous good is present in the article. If the article contains more than one dangerous good and these could react dangerously with one another during transport, each of the dangerous goods shall be enclosed separately (see 4.1.1.6).
